# frozen_string_literal: true
RSpec.describe RuboCop::Cop::Style::RaiseArgs, :config do
context 'when enforced style is compact' do
let(:cop_config) { { 'EnforcedStyle' => 'compact' } }
context 'with a raise with 2 args' do
it 'reports an offense' do
expect_offense(<<~RUBY)
raise RuntimeError, msg
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 Provide an exception object as an argument to `raise`.
RUBY
expect_correction(<<~RUBY)
raise RuntimeError.new(msg)
RUBY
end
end
context 'when used in a ternary expression' do
it 'registers an offense and auto-corrects' do
expect_offense(<<~RUBY)
foo ? raise(Ex, 'error') : bar
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 Provide an exception object as an argument to `raise`.
RUBY
expect_correction(<<~RUBY)
foo ? raise(Ex.new('error')) : bar
RUBY
end
end
context 'when used in a logical and expression' do
it 'registers an offense and auto-corrects' do
expect_offense(<<~RUBY)
bar && raise(Ex, 'error')
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 Provide an exception object as an argument to `raise`.
RUBY
expect_correction(<<~RUBY)
bar && raise(Ex.new('error'))
RUBY
end
end
context 'when used in a logical or expression' do
it 'registers an offense and auto-corrects' do
expect_offense(<<~RUBY)
bar || raise(Ex, 'error')
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 Provide an exception object as an argument to `raise`.
RUBY
expect_correction(<<~RUBY)
bar || raise(Ex.new('error'))
RUBY
end
end
context 'with correct + opposite' do
it 'reports an offense' do
expect_offense(<<~RUBY)
if a
raise RuntimeError, msg
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 Provide an exception object as an argument to `raise`.
else
raise Ex.new(msg)
end
RUBY
expect_correction(<<~RUBY)
if a
raise RuntimeError.new(msg)
else
raise Ex.new(msg)
end
RUBY
end
it 'reports multiple offenses' do
expect_offense(<<~RUBY)
if a
raise RuntimeError, msg
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 Provide an exception object as an argument to `raise`.
elsif b
raise Ex.new(msg)
else
raise ArgumentError, msg
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 Provide an exception object as an argument to `raise`.
end
RUBY
expect_correction(<<~RUBY)
if a
raise RuntimeError.new(msg)
elsif b
raise Ex.new(msg)
else
raise ArgumentError.new(msg)
end
RUBY
end
end
context 'with a raise with 3 args' do
it 'reports an offense' do
expect_offense(<<~RUBY)
raise RuntimeError, msg, caller
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 Provide an exception object as an argument to `raise`.
RUBY
expect_no_corrections
end
end
it 'accepts a raise with msg argument' do
expect_no_offenses('raise msg')
end
it 'accepts a raise with an exception argument' do
expect_no_offenses('raise Ex.new(msg)')
end
end
context 'when enforced style is exploded' do
let(:cop_config) { { 'EnforcedStyle' => 'exploded' } }
context 'with a raise with exception object' do
context 'with one argument' do
it 'reports an offense' do
expect_offense(<<~RUBY)
raise Ex.new(msg)
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 Provide an exception class and message as arguments to `raise`.
RUBY
expect_correction(<<~RUBY)
raise Ex, msg
RUBY
end
end
context 'with no arguments' do
it 'reports an offense' do
expect_offense(<<~RUBY)
raise Ex.new
^^^^^^^^^^^^ Provide an exception class and message as arguments to `raise`.
RUBY
expect_correction(<<~RUBY)
raise Ex
RUBY
end
end
context 'when used in a ternary expression' do
it 'registers an offense and auto-corrects' do
expect_offense(<<~RUBY)
foo ? raise(Ex.new('error')) : bar
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 Provide an exception class and message as arguments to `raise`.
RUBY
expect_correction(<<~RUBY)
foo ? raise(Ex, 'error') : bar
RUBY
end
end
context 'when used in a logical and expression' do
it 'registers an offense and auto-corrects' do
expect_offense(<<~RUBY)
bar && raise(Ex.new('error'))
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 Provide an exception class and message as arguments to `raise`.
RUBY
expect_correction(<<~RUBY)
bar && raise(Ex, 'error')
RUBY
end
end
context 'when used in a logical or expression' do
it 'registers an offense and auto-corrects' do
expect_offense(<<~RUBY)
bar || raise(Ex.new('error'))
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 Provide an exception class and message as arguments to `raise`.
RUBY
expect_correction(<<~RUBY)
bar || raise(Ex, 'error')
RUBY
end
end
end
context 'with opposite + correct' do
it 'reports an offense for opposite + correct' do
expect_offense(<<~RUBY)
if a
raise RuntimeError, msg
else
raise Ex.new(msg)
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 Provide an exception class and message as arguments to `raise`.
end
RUBY
expect_correction(<<~RUBY)
if a
raise RuntimeError, msg
else
raise Ex, msg
end
RUBY
end
it 'reports multiple offenses' do
expect_offense(<<~RUBY)
if a
raise RuntimeError, msg
elsif b
raise Ex.new(msg)
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 Provide an exception class and message as arguments to `raise`.
else
raise ArgumentError.new(msg)
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 Provide an exception class and message as arguments to `raise`.
end
RUBY
expect_correction(<<~RUBY)
if a
raise RuntimeError, msg
elsif b
raise Ex, msg
else
raise ArgumentError, msg
end
RUBY
end
end
context 'when an exception object is assigned to a local variable' do
it 'auto-corrects to exploded style' do
expect_offense(<<~RUBY)
def do_something
klass = RuntimeError
raise klass.new('hi')
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 Provide an exception class and message as arguments to `raise`.
end
RUBY
expect_correction(<<~RUBY)
def do_something
klass = RuntimeError
raise klass, 'hi'
end
RUBY
end
end
it 'accepts exception constructor with more than 1 argument' do
expect_no_offenses('raise MyCustomError.new(a1, a2, a3)')
end
it 'accepts exception constructor with keyword arguments' do
expect_no_offenses('raise MyKwArgError.new(a: 1, b: 2)')
end
it 'accepts a raise with splatted arguments' do
expect_no_offenses('raise MyCustomError.new(*args)')
end
it 'accepts a raise with 3 args' do
expect_no_offenses('raise RuntimeError, msg, caller')
end
it 'accepts a raise with 2 args' do
expect_no_offenses('raise RuntimeError, msg')
end
it 'accepts a raise with msg argument' do
expect_no_offenses('raise msg')
end
end
end
